statchute.xyz
507 Subscribers
188274 Views
688 Videos
None
#3091
Subscriber Rank
#3445
View Rank
#2107
Video Rank
2 +0%
Subs in the last 30 days
3290 +1.9%
Views in the last 30 days
9 +200%
Videos in the last 30 days